Transaction 75c16f5f5217376a0e8e3904feed5a54e18efa80f763bb228e3faaa55f8dabb5
1 Input
1 Output
-
75c16f5f5217376a0e8e3904feed5a54e18efa80f763bb228e3faaa55f8dabb5:0
- value
- 577986876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e3c94a09ee3cffe49cbaadb3e67b52466f52802 OP_EQUAL
- address
- 38phCie4gZLi4MZP4wxdCgABwBZE83MMAv